A large fossil of a prehistoric Cladocyclus fish sourced from an ex private British collection.

Discovered in Brazil, this impressive piece of natural history has been preserved by time over millions of years.

Backed on a matrix and displaying on custom made display stand, this is a fantastic interior display piece, showcasing the anatomy of this impressive historic creature in intricate detail.

It has preserved exceptionally with details of its scales, fins and head still recognisable through fossilisation over millions of years. It’s up turned mouth, tail, and long shape suggests that it was a large surface predator.
